There is no city tax assessed in any city in Indiana.
Indiana resident pay a state tax rate of 3.3%, plus most counties have a local income tax at rates that vary depending on the county. A list of the county tax rates in Indiana can be found at http://www.in.gov/dor/files/dn01.pdf.
State and county taxes should be withheld from your pay and noted on the W-2 you received. TurboTax will account for you state and county taxes on your Indiana return.
You may owe real estate or other property taxes, depending on what you own in Indiana, and you pay sales tax on most purchases, but those taxes are not assessed or collected on your income tax return.
